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is focused on self-aligned via interconnect structures. This patent discloses methods of manufacturing these structures, which include forming a wiring structure in a dielectric material. The process involves creating a cap layer over the surface of the wiring structure and the dielectric material. An opening is then formed in the cap layer to expose a portion of the wiring structure. The method further includes selectively growing a metal or metal-alloy via interconnect structure material on the exposed portion of the wiring structure through the opening in the cap layer. Finally, an upper wiring structure is formed in electrical contact with the metal or metal-alloy via interconnect structure.
